## Who to ping about GiftNote

Welcome aboard! GiftNote is our donation-receipt mailer for the Larchfield Fund. Template tweaks go to the comms folks; delivery failures and bounce weirdness go to the platform crew. Don't push template changes on Fridays — receipts batch over the weekend. For anything GiftNote-related, start with the address below.

billing contact of kaweg-tajeg = drudor.lamion.oliath@torvalabs.test

Subject: DR drill Thursday — autocomplete index heads-up

Hey, quick note before Thursday's disaster-recovery drill at Plovercrest. The autocomplete index on the Murmur search tier has been rebuilding slowly all week, so when we fail over to the Kestrel region, expect suggestions to lag a few minutes. Don't panic and don't roll back — just let the warmer catch up. Everything else should cut over cleanly. If the drill requires you to unseal the standby coordinator, use the recovery passphrase below.

vault phrase of yahif-hahaf = istael-gorir-fenwyn-belael-novys-novok-juldor

**Facilities Ticket #—**

Hi team — we've got a contractor from Quillbarn Fitouts starting a week of ceiling work in the Larchview Annex on Monday. Please sort a hi-vis locker, parking spot, and access to the service stairwell. They'll check in at the Pinefold Street desk each morning. The stairwell keypad is their main route, so they'll need the code below.

staff pass of kawip-hawef = bdg-QLP-2